5. DePIN Model
Kairos aligns naturally with the decentralized physical infrastructure network (DePIN) ethos, breaking the bottlenecks of centralized AI services through edge‑device onboarding, serverless task scheduling, on‑chain agent deployment, and native incentives. Every device, user, and agent becomes a resource contributor, compute collaborator, and value participant.
5.1 Edge Devices as DePIN Nodes
Any device with idle compute/storage—home GPUs, ARM boards, phones, micro‑servers—can register as an edge node via lightweight protocols. After identity mapping and performance evaluation, nodes enter the scheduling network, providing inference, caching, and context processing.
